We are happy to invite you to the Joint Meeting on Semantics, the European Electronic Health Record Exchange Format, and Communities of (Interoperable) Practice organized by XpanDH, the CSCT asbl, SNOMED International and xShare.

During this half-day session, we will explore together how terminologies fit into the overall picture of the European Health Data Space under construction, and how Europe is supporting this digital transition.

The conference will be held as an hybrid event, both online and on site at the Bastenie auditorium, CHU Saint-Pierre, 322 rue Haute, 1000 Bruxelles, in preamble to the SNOMED in Europe congress of the 22nd and 23rd of May.

For the on site event, there is limited seating (100 places) so please do not book a physical place if you don't intend to come on site.

The conference program is the following:

  12:30 - Registration open and guest greeting

  13:30 - Welcome and introduction:
          Marie-Alexandra Lambot (CHUSP/CSCT),
          Henrique Martins (ISCTE/XpanDH),
          Ian Green (SNOMED international),
          Luc Nicolas (EHTEL/xShare WP4 co-lead)

 13:50 - Semantic as the key asset on eHealth interoperability:
          Dr Marie-Alexandra Lambot (CHUSP/CSCT)

 14:10 – XpanDH project: Semantics and people interoperability:
          Henrique Martins (ISCTE/XpanDH)

 14:30 - Presentation of the xShare project:
          Luc Nicolas (EHTEL/xShare WP4 co-lead)

 14:50 - Coffee break

 15:10 - The role of SNOMED CT in EHDS:
          Ian Green (SNOMED international)

 15:30 - The role of Industry in semantics and how to get ready for the European EHR Exchange Format:
          Henrique Martins (ISCTE/XpanDH),
          Luc Nicolas (EHTEL/xShare WP4 co-lead)

 15:50 - Discussion breakout groups on how to engage the eHealth ecosystem on the Semantic issues, and find solutions exploring the EEHRxFormat
   • Group 1: Exploring the European EHR Exchange Format and Engagement of industry and wider society
   • Group 2: Engagement of EU and policy makers towards the semantic interoperability

 16:50 - Presentations of the breakout groups results and general discussion

 17:20 - Wrap-up and final considerations:
           Marie-Alexandra Lambot (CHUSP/CSCT),
           Henrique Martins (ISCTE/XpanDH),
           Ian Green (SNOMED international),
           Luc Nicolas (EHTEL/xShare WP4 co-lead)

 17:30 - Networking drink
